Less energy to run

When the washing machine is switched on, it consumes energy from two main sources heating equipment that produces the hot water mix needed for washing and electric motor that rotates the drum. The amount of energy a machine consumes is based on its size and the washing cycle you select. A bigger washing machine is likely to consume more energy than a smaller one, but it will also clean your laundry faster and more effectively than a smaller one.

In general, larger machines are also more efficient than smaller ones and can use up to 10 percent less energy for each kg of laundry when compared to smaller or mid-size appliances. However, the amount of energy your washing machine consumes will mainly depend on the load you use it for and your habits of energy consumption.

Less noise

A machine weighing 10kg will have a bigger drum that means it produces less noise when spinning and washing. This is an important benefit for those living in flat shares or open-plan living areas where they share their laundry space with householders. A noisy washer can get on your nerves, especially when you're working from home or have guests to eat dinner with. A quiet washing machine is an essential item for anyone who wants to keep their home and working spaces as tranquil and serene as is possible.

Larger washing machines also produce less banging noises when they're spinning and draining. This is due to the fact that they have more robust, thicker casings and are designed to be as well-insulated as is possible. If your washing machine is making loud noises, it could indicate that there are loose items within the drum or tub. This can damage the machine, and must be addressed as soon as is possible to prevent further damage.

You should also check that your device isn't overloaded since this can create more noise and use more energy than it needs to. The sound of a constant banging is usually caused by zippers or buttons stuck between the drum and lid. It could also occur if the door seal is damaged and water seeps in to the casing.
